LoadIcon, LoadIconBynum |
VB声明 |
|
Declare Function LoadIcon& Lib "user32" Alias "LoadIconA" (ByVal hInstance As Long, ByVal lpIconName As String) Declare Function LoadIconBynum& Lib "user32" Alias "LoadIconA" (ByVal hInstance As Long, ByVal lpIconName As Long) |
|
说明 |
|
从指定的模块或应用程序实例中载入一个图标。其中,LoadIconBynum是LoadIcon函数的类型安全声明 |
|
返回值 |
|
Long,执行成功则返回已载入的图标的句柄;零表示失败。会设置GetLastError |
|
参数表 |
|
参数 |
类型及说明 |
hInstance |
Long,一个DLL的模块句柄;或者一个实例句柄,指定包含了图标的可执行程序 |
lpIconName |
String,作为一个字串,指定欲载入的图标资源。作为一个长整数值,指定欲载入的资源ID;或者设置一个常数,代表某幅固有系统图标。如装载的是一个固有系统图标,注意hInstance参数应设为零。在api32.txt文件中以前缀IDI_ 作为标志 |
|
|
注解 |
|
在Windows 95和Win16环境中,这个函数只能载入标准尺寸的图标。用GetSystemMetrics可以获得SM_CXICON 和 SM_CYICON标准图标设置。用LoadImage则可载入非标准尺寸的图标 文件中可能包含了同一个图标资源的多种版本。这个函数会自动挑选与当前显示模式最相配的一种 |
Top |